Surface modifications of coir fibres involving alkali treatment, bleaching,
and vinyl grafting are made in view of their use as reinforcing agents in
general-purpose polyester resin matrix. The mechanical properties of compos
ites like tensile, flexural and impact strength increase as a result of sur
face modification. Among all modifications, bleached (65 degreesC) coir-pol
yester composites show better flexural strength (61.6 MPa) whereas 2% alkal
i-treated coir/polyester composites show significant improvement in tensile
strength (26.80 MPa). Hybrid composites comprising glass fibre mat (7 wt.%
), coir fibre mat (13 wt.%) and polyester resin matrix are prepared. Hybrid
composites containing surface modified coir fibres show significant improv
ement in flexural strength. Water absorption studies of coir/polyester and
hybrid composites show significant reduction in water absorption due to sur
face modifications of coir fibres. Scanning electron microscopy (SEM) inves
tigations show that surface modifications improve the fibre/ matrix adhesio
